JUSTICE RAJENDRA KUMAR MISHRA ORAL ORDER 27-07-2016 Heard learned counsel for the petitioner and the learned A.P.P. for the State.
The petitioner is accused in connection with Naokothi P.S. Case No. 12 of 2016 registered under Sections 302/34 and 120(B) of the Indian Penal Code, Section 27 of the Arms Act and Sections 3(2)(v) of the S.C.S.T. Act.
The accusation is that, on 27.02.2016, Swati Kumari, daughter of informant, was shot dead on P.C.C. road in course of returning from her school. The informant on receiving information about murder of his daughter went there and found his daughter dead. He raised suspicion against Prince Kumar Mahto, son of Rameshwar Mahto, who is the accused in a rape case lodged by the deceased, daughter of informant, as he was given threatening
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.21996 of 2016 (3) dt.27-07-2016 of dire consequences.
Learned counsel for the petitioner submits that petitioner is not named in the F.I.R. rather in course of investigation the police got recorded the confessional statement of Rameshwar Mahto, father of named accused Prince Kumar, who disclosed that under conspiracy of Prince Kumar, Rameshwar Mahto and Karnal Paswan shot fire at the deceased and this petitioner was driving the motorcycle, on which, both were sitting on the said motorcycle. It is further submitted that petitioner has no criminal antecedent and is in custody since 31.03.2016. Having regard to the facts and the circumstances of the case, the petitioner above named, is directed to be released on bail on furnishing bail bond of Rs.10,000/-(Rupees Ten Th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of the J.M. Ist Class, Begusarai, in connection with Naokothi P.S. Case No. 12 of 2016. Out of two sureties, one surety must be the close relative of the petitioner.
